Defining Bed Space

In simple terms, bed space refers to a living space where individual rooms or designated areas are rented out, typically by multiple occupants sharing common facilities. This arrangement offers a practical solution to housing challenges, particularly in urban settings like Tecom, where the cost of living can occasionally hit the roof.

Consider a few points:

  • Affordability: Renting a bed space often costs less than securing an entire apartment, making it budget-friendly for many.
  • Roommate Dynamics: The shared living arrangement fosters a sense of community, allowing residents to forge connections with diverse individuals.
  • Flexibility: Many bed space agreements are short-term, catering to those who travel frequently or are in the area temporarily.

However, it's not just about saving pennies. The concept of bed space encompasses lifestyle choices and personal preferences. Someone might opt for bed space in Tecom to experience a bustling environment, making the most of the area's vibrant energy.

Cost-Effectiveness

One of the most significant draws of renting a bed space is undoubtedly its cost-effectiveness. Affordability remains a top priority for many looking to settle in Dubai, especially for expatriates or young professionals. Rent can often skyrocket in metropolitan areas, and Tecom is no exception. By opting for a bed space, individuals can significantly reduce their housing costs while still enjoying a decent standard of living.

For instance, consider this: a one-bedroom apartment in Tecom might set an individual back a couple of thousand dirhams per month. Contrastingly, bed spaces can be found for a fraction of that price. This means that residents can maintain a budget-friendly lifestyle, saving that surplus for other expenses like dining and entertainment.

The choice to rent a bed space can translate into financial breathing room, allowing individuals to invest in experiences rather than just shelter.

Flexibility for Expatriates

Flexibility is another remarkable advantage that bed space rentals provide, particularly for expatriates who may find themselves in constant transition. Many come to Dubai for temporary work assignments and appreciate housing arrangements that don't lock them into long commitments. A bed space rental often operates on a month-to-month basis, making it simple for tenants to adjust their living conditions as their personal and professional lives evolve.

Moreover, such arrangements promote a less stressful move-in and move-out process that can save time and hassle. It offers the freedom to explore various neighborhoods and accommodations without the chains of a traditional lease holding you down. This is particularly relevant in a diverse and ever-changing city like Dubai, where opportunities and circumstances can shift with the breeze.

Regulatory Constraints

Regulatory frameworks in Dubai can often seem like a labyrinth, especially for newcomers trying to rent or invest in bed spaces. The government enacts stringent rules aimed at maintaining a balance between growth and sustainability. For example, property leasing regulations are frequently updated to adapt to market needs and consumer protection standards.

It's not uncommon for landlords to need specific permits or licenses before they can rent out bed spaces. This not only adds layers of complexity but also requires significant knowledge about legal frameworks, which may not be readily accessible to expatriates or casual renters.

Key elements to consider include:

  • Documentation Requirements: Ensure all paperwork is in order, including tenancy agreements that protect both parties.
  • Length of Lease Agreements: Many leases have a minimum duration, affecting flexibility.
  • Housing Authority Standards: Compliance with local authority regulations can be stringent and require ongoing assessments.

Navigating these waters is critical because non-compliance can lead to hefty fines or inability to operate legally in the market.

Market Saturation Risks

Tecom presents a vibrant atmosphere filled with opportunities, but this vibrancy often attracts a myriad of stakeholders, resulting in market saturation risks. As more developers jump on the bandwagon to capitalize on the growing demand for bed spaces, the market can quickly become crowded.

When saturation occurs, it's not just the availability that's affected; quality often takes a backseat as competition drives prices down. This can make it difficult for investors to find premium bed spaces that provide the returns they desire.

Some important markers to keep in mind are:

  • Price Wars: Increased competition can lead landlords to lower their rental prices in a bid to attract tenants, which might benefit renters short-term but affect investment returns.
  • Quality over Quantity: With more options available, finding higher-quality accommodations may require digging deeper.
  • Potential for Empty Units: Oversupply can lead to vacancies, impacting overall profitability and market stability.

Being aware of these dynamics can help investors and renters navigate the landscape without getting caught in the slump that saturation can bring.

Quality Control Issues

With rapid developments and a growing number of options, quality control in Tecom's bed space market becomes inherently challenging. The reality is that not all available accommodations meet the standards that tenants might expect.

Investors must be vigilant. Here are some concerns to keep an eye on:

  • Inconsistent Maintenance: Properties can vary greatly in upkeep and amenities, which is crucial for tenant satisfaction.
  • Subpar Management: Providers or landlords who donโ€™t prioritize good management can lead to poor living conditions, affecting resident experience.
  • Fly-By-Night Operators: The allure of quick returns can tempt less scrupulous operators to enter the market, potentially leading to quality issues.

To safeguard against these problems, potential renters should do their due diligence by researching properties extensively, reading reviews, and considering more established landlords with a good track record.

Understanding these challenges helps tenants and investors alike to approach the Tecom bed space market with eyes wide open, ensuring decisions made are informed and sound.
